Output 80efc6bbc2863ae75bdb80380dfa725af3283e6d26b38cffc05c775580e36615:0

value
102500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eebd3f62467e7c90eb3c35a75fdd3f463a0820bc OP_EQUAL
address
3PTMTMQj7mRzn7HzuLLK7w28L2BTDgTVq4
transaction
80efc6bbc2863ae75bdb80380dfa725af3283e6d26b38cffc05c775580e36615
spent
true